La scoperta di un paradigma complesso. L'«Unternehmen» nel diritto commerciale e nella dottrina austro-tedesca del primo Novecento

2010

Dai primi anni del Novecento, senza una precisa definizione legislativa, senza un tessuto normativo coerente ed univoco, la scienza giuridica austro-tedesca ripensò in profondità la nuova realtà economico-sociale dell’Europa industriale, scoprendo e giuridicamente rappresentando, in tempo di «individualismo atomizzante», la dimensione collettiva ed organizzativa del fenomeno imprenditoriale. Instituciones e intereses en conflicto ante la regulación contable internacional: el caso del sector financiero español

2014

ResumenEl trabajo analiza las interrelaciones entre las normas contables y la información financiera que elaboran las empresas y las instituciones y los incentivos empresariales a fin de contribuir al debate sobre el futuro de las Normas Internacionales de Información Financiera (NIIF). Se destaca que las diferencias en las instituciones —y en concreto en el control de la aplicación de las normas— hacen muy difícil la comparabilidad de la información, lo que impide lograr todas las ventajas que podría conllevar la adopción de las NIIF. "Table 3" of "Search for long-lived, heavy particles in final states with a muon and multi-track displaced vertex in proton-proton collisions at sqrt…

2012

Event selection efficiency vs mean proper decay length The MH, HH, ML suffix used for overlaying the graphs refers to the combinations of squark and neutralino masses in the signal MC sample: MH is 700GeV squarks and 494GeV neutralinos, HH is 1.5TeV squarks and 494GeV neutralinos, and ML is 700GeV squarks and 108GeV neutralinos. The tables show the efficiency for reconstructing a signal event, where at least one vertex candidate passes all selection requirements, as a function of the proper decay length c*tau of the neutralino.
